Abstract: This disclosure is directed to devices, systems, and techniques for determining one or more phase relationships. A medical device system includes a memory and processing circuitry in communication with the memory. The processing circuitry is configured to receive a plurality of electrical signals which indicate a phase relationship between two or more tissue regions within a target area of neural tissue of a patient. Additionally, the processing circuitry is configured to determine, based on the plurality of electrical signals, the phase relationship between the two or more tissue regions, and compare the phase relationship with a target phase relationship for the two or more tissue regions within the target area. The processing circuitry is further configured to determine, based on the comparison, one or more parameters of stimulation for delivery to the patient and cause a therapy delivery circuit to determine the stimulation.

Abstract: This disclosure is directed to devices, systems, and techniques for delivering electrical stimulation. In some examples, a system includes processing circuitry configured to: receive information representative of a bioelectric brain signal recorded from a brain of a patient; and determine, based on the information, at least one pathological frequency of the bioelectric brain signal. Additionally, the processing circuitry is configured to select, based on the at least one pathological frequency, a sequence of pulse bursts at a pulse burst frequency, the sequence of pulse bursts at least partially defining electrical stimulation deliverable to an area of a brain of a patient, wherein adjacent pulse bursts within the sequence comprise different intra-burst pulse frequencies; and control a medical device to deliver the electrical stimulation comprising the sequence of pulse bursts to the area of the brain of the patient.

Abstract: Devices, systems, and techniques are described for identifying stimulation parameter values based on electrical stimulation that induces dyskinesia for the patient. For example, a method may include controlling, by processing circuitry, a medical device to deliver electrical stimulation to a portion of a brain of a patient, receiving, by the processing circuitry, information representative of an electrical signal sensed from the brain after delivery of the electrical stimulation, determining, by the processing circuitry and from the information representative of the electrical signal, a peak in a spectral power of the electrical signal at a second frequency lower than a first frequency of the electrical stimulation, and responsive to determining the peak in the spectral power of the electrical signal at the second frequency, performing, by the processing circuitry, an action.

Abstract: A medical device for providing electrical stimulation to a brain of a patient includes one or more processors. The one or more processors are configured to determine a first set of parameters of a first electrical signal that is delivered via a first electrode configured to apply electrical stimulation to a first region of the brain and to determine a second set of parameters of a second electrical signal based on the first set of parameters. The second electrical signal is delivered via a second electrode configured to apply electrical stimulation to a second region of the brain. The one or more processors are further configured to deliver, with the first electrode, the first electrical signal having the first set of parameters and to deliver, with the second electrode, the second electrical signal having the second set of parameters.

Abstract: An example method includes determining, by an implantable medical device (IMD), an electrode of a plurality of electrodes of a lead to be used to deliver electrical stimulation to a patient at a particular time; selecting, by the IMD and based on the determined electrode, a set of electrodes of the plurality of electrodes; and sensing, by the IMD and via the selected set of electrodes, electrical signals of the patient at the particular time.
